【問114】
データベース設計において、データの重複を避けてデータの一貫性を保つための手法はどれか?
A. トランザクションは、データベースの操作を一つの単位として管理する手法である。
B. 正規化は、データの重複を避けるためのデータベース設計の手法である。
C. ロールバックは、トランザクションの処理を取り消す手法である。
D. インデックスは、データの検索を効率化するためのデータ構造である。
ITパスポート試験 問114 データベース設計において、データの重複を避けてデータの一貫性を保つための手法はどれか?
解答と解説
👋 こんにちは、ITパスポート試験に挑戦する皆さん! 今回の問題の正解は 選択肢B: 正規化です!(≧▽≦) 正規化は、データの冗長性を減らし、データベースの整合性を保つための手法なんです。つまり、同じデータが何回も記録されてしまうのを防ぐことができるんですよ😉 例えば、顧客情報を登録する際に、同じ住所を何度も入力する必要がなくなり、管理が楽になります!これにより、データが整った状態を保つことができるんです。各選択肢の詳細解説
選択肢A: トランザクション
トランザクションは、一連のデータ操作をまとめて管理するための手法です。つまり、データの整合性を保つためのツールですが、データの構造自体を改善するものではありません。(^_^;) 例えば、銀行の振り込みを考えてみましょう。振り込みが完了するまでの一連の操作をトランザクションとして扱い、どれか一つでも失敗したら全部元に戻すことで、データの整合性を確保します。✨ ここがポイント!✨ トランザクションはデータ操作のまとまりを管理するものです。
選択肢C: ロールバック
ロールバックは、トランザクション内の操作を取り消す手法です。つまり、失敗した操作を元に戻すことができるんですよ。ただし、データの重複を回避することには直接関与しません。(・_・;) たとえば、間違ってデータを削除してしまった場合、その操作をロールバックすることで元の状態に戻すことができます。✨ ここがポイント!✨ ロールバックは操作の取り消しを行うものです。
選択肢D: インデックス
インデックスは、データ検索を高速化するための構造です。つまり、データの一貫性を維持するものではないんです。(^_^;) 例えば、図書館で本を探すときに、目録があるとすぐに見つけやすいですよね。インデックスもそれと同じようにデータを素早く見つけるための手助けをします。✨ ここがポイント!✨ インデックスはデータ検索を高速化するために使われます。
この問題の重要ポイント
基礎知識
この問題で問われている重要なIT知識は データベースの正規化です。データの重複を避け、一貫性を保つために必要な手法を理解しておくことが大切です!🎯 これだけは覚えておこう!
- 正規化はデータの冗長性を減らす手法
- トランザクションはデータ操作のまとまりを管理するもの
- ロールバックは操作の取り消しを行うもの
- インデックスはデータ検索を高速化するための構造
類似問題と出題傾向
過去の類似問題
類似問題として、データベースの整合性を保つための手法や、データの管理方法に関する問題が出題されることが多いです。これらはITパスポート試験でよく問われるトピックなので、しっかりと理解しておきましょう!⚠️ こんな問題にも注意!
- データベースの正常化に関する問題
- トランザクション管理の方法に関する問題
コメント